Dealer did some re-reprogramming to turn my eyebrow lights on. in the process they determined that my "after-market LED's were causing the problem". I am pretty sure this is a steaming pile of horse puckey, however, just wondering if anyone else has similar experience.

Background:
The eyebrows on my car did not work from the time I bought my car (late 2008). I had it in a couple of times, but they were never able to activate them (some storeys about BMW not allowing dealers to do manual programming, )

OEM angel eyes worked, eyebrows did not.

recently blew an OEM angel eye bulb. replaced them both with MTEC V2's. (thanks BRABUS), no faults, no errors

Had an oil change done friday and they were finally able to turn on the eyebrows, but put in OEM angel eye bulbs and kept my MTEC V2's. only discovered this late last night. I misunderstood my SA and thought they replaced the eyebrow bulbs.

I have already left a message for my guy aksing him to return my after-market bulbs

If I put them in, are my eyebrows suddenly going to turn off??

There are at least two instances of CIPS/PROGMAN software bugs that inadvertently disables the eyebrow lights:

Eyebrow Lights Are Inoperative After Programming
After programming with CIP 17.00 or 17.01, the eyebrow lights do not illuminate on vehicles equipped with halogen lights.

Eyebrow Lights are Inoperative after Programming
After programming with Progman V23.02.00, V24.01.00 or V24.01.01, the eyebrow lights do not illuminate.

A later software update will definitely fix the disabled eyebrow lights. I had a software update performed on my E60 to reenable the eyebrow lights a couple of years ago. I also recently installed the MTEC v2 LED angel eyes. No issue to report.
